//=--------------------------------------------------------------------------=
// CDownloadDialog::SafeMessageBox
//=--------------------------------------------------------------------------=
// Helper method that uses best availble API to show native error/information
// dialog. In particular, it uses TaskDialog if availble (Vista specific)
// and MessageBox otherwise.
//
// It also ensures that the message box is always displayed on top of
// the progress dialog instead of underneath
//

//helper structures to define XP vs Vista style differences
static TASKDIALOG_COMMON_BUTTON_FLAGS vistaDialogButtons[] = {
    TDCBF_RETRY_BUTTON | TDCBF_CANCEL_BUTTON,
    TDCBF_OK_BUTTON | TDCBF_CANCEL_BUTTON
};
static PCWSTR vistaIcons[] = {
    TD_ERROR_ICON,
    TD_WARNING_ICON
};

static UINT xpStyle[] = {
    MB_ICONERROR | MB_RETRYCANCEL,
    MB_ICONWARNING | MB_OKCANCEL | MB_DEFBUTTON2
};

int CDownloadDialog::SafeMessageBox(UINT details, UINT mainInstruction, UINT caption, DialogType type, LPCWSTR instructionArg, LPCWSTR detailsArg) {
    WCHAR textCaption[BUFFER_SIZE+1];
    WCHAR textDetails[BUFFER_SIZE+1];
    WCHAR textInstruction[BUFFER_SIZE+1];
    WCHAR tmpBuffer[BUFFER_SIZE+1];

    /* make sure buffers are terminated */
    textCaption[BUFFER_SIZE] = textDetails[BUFFER_SIZE] = 0;
    textInstruction[BUFFER_SIZE] = tmpBuffer[BUFFER_SIZE] = 0;

    if (detailsArg != NULL) {
        ::LoadStringW(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                 details,
                 tmpBuffer,
                 BUFFER_SIZE);
        _snwprintf(textDetails, BUFFER_SIZE, tmpBuffer, detailsArg);
    } else {
        ::LoadStringW(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                 details,
                 textDetails,
                 BUFFER_SIZE);
    }

    if (instructionArg != NULL) {
        ::LoadStringW(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                 mainInstruction,
                 tmpBuffer,
                 BUFFER_SIZE);
        _snwprintf(textInstruction, BUFFER_SIZE, tmpBuffer, instructionArg);
     } else {
        ::LoadStringW(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                 mainInstruction,
                 textInstruction,
                 BUFFER_SIZE);
     }

    ::LoadStringW(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                 caption,
                 textCaption,
                 BUFFER_SIZE);

    __try
    {
        m_csMessageBox.Lock();
        if (m_dialogUp) {
            waitUntilInitialized();
        }
        /* If TaskDialog availble - use it! */
        if (taskDialogFn != NULL) {
              TASKDIALOGCONFIG tc = { 0 };
              int nButton;

              tc.cbSize = sizeof(tc);
              tc.hwndParent = ::IsWindow(m_hWnd) ? m_hWnd : NULL;
              tc.dwCommonButtons = vistaDialogButtons[type];
              tc.pszWindowTitle = textCaption;
              tc.pszMainInstruction = textInstruction;
              tc.pszContent = textDetails;
              tc.pszMainIcon = vistaIcons[type];
              /* workaround: we need to make sure Cancel is default
                             for this type of Dialog */
              if (type == DIALOG_WARNING_CANCELOK) {
                  tc.nDefaultButton = IDCANCEL;
              }

              taskDialogFn(&tc, &nButton, NULL, NULL);
              return nButton;
        } else { /* default: use MessageBox */
            /* Note that MessageBox API expects content as single string
               and therefore we need to concatenate instruction
               and details as 2 paragraphs.

               The only exception is empty instruction. */
            if (wcslen(textInstruction) > 0) {
                wcsncat(textInstruction, L"\n\n",
                        BUFFER_SIZE - wcslen(textInstruction));
            }
            wcsncat(textInstruction, textDetails,
                    BUFFER_SIZE - wcslen(textInstruction));

            return ::MessageBoxW(::IsWindow(m_hWnd) ? m_hWnd : NULL,
                textInstruction, textCaption, xpStyle[type]);
        }
    }
    __finally
    {
        m_csMessageBox.Unlock();
    }
}

LRESULT CDownloadDialog::OnTimer(UINT uMsg, WPARAM wParam, LPARAM lParam, BOOL& bHandled)
{
    if (destroyWindowTimerID == (int)wParam) {
        KillTimer(destroyWindowTimerID);
        m_destroyWindowTimerStarted = FALSE;
        m_ulProgressMax = max(0, m_ulProgressMax - m_ulProgress);
        logProgress();
        m_ulProgress = 0;
        logProgress();
        m_feedbackOnCancel = FALSE;
        ::PostMessage(m_hWnd, WM_COMMAND, IDCANCEL, NULL);
    }

    if (iTimerID == (int)wParam)
    {

        __try
        {
            m_csDownload.Lock();

            HWND hStatusWnd = GetDlgItem(IDC_TIME_REMAINING);
            HWND hProgressWnd = GetDlgItem(IDC_DOWNLOAD_PROGRESS);

            if (m_ulProgress && m_ulProgressMax)
            {
                ::PostMessage(hProgressWnd, PBM_SETPOS,
                     (WPARAM) (m_ulProgress * 100
                        / m_ulProgressMax), NULL);

                time_t currentTime;
                time(&currentTime);

                double elapsed_time = difftime(currentTime, m_startTime);
                double remain_time = (elapsed_time / m_ulProgress) *
                                      (m_ulProgressMax - m_ulProgress);
                int hr = 0, min = 0;

                if (remain_time > 60 * 60)
                {
                    hr = int(remain_time / (60 * 60));
                    remain_time = remain_time - hr * 60 * 60;
                }

                if (remain_time > 60)
                {
                    min = int(remain_time / 60);
                    remain_time = remain_time - min * 60;
                }

                TCHAR szBuffer[BUFFER_SIZE];
                TCHAR szTimeBuffer[BUFFER_SIZE];

                if (hr > 0)
                {
                    if (hr > 1)
                        LoadString(_Module.GetResourceInstance(), IDS_HOURSMINUTESECOND,
                                   szTimeBuffer, BUFFER_SIZE);
                    else
                        LoadString(_Module.GetResourceInstance(), IDS_HOURMINUTESECOND,
                                   szTimeBuffer, BUFFER_SIZE);

                    sprintf(szBuffer, szTimeBuffer, hr, min, remain_time);
                }
                else
                {
                    if (min > 0)
                    {
                        LoadString(_Module.GetResourceInstance(), IDS_MINUTESECOND,
                                   szTimeBuffer, BUFFER_SIZE);
                        sprintf(szBuffer, szTimeBuffer, min, remain_time);

                    }
                    else
                    {
                        LoadString(_Module.GetResourceInstance(), IDS_SECOND,
                                   szTimeBuffer, BUFFER_SIZE);
                        sprintf(szBuffer, szTimeBuffer, remain_time);

                    }
                }

                if (m_ulProgress == m_ulProgressMax) {
                    // download is done, unpacking bundle now, and waiting
                    // for another download to take place
                    ::LoadString(_Module.GetResourceInstance(),
                            IDS_DOWNLOAD_UNPACKING, szBuffer, BUFFER_SIZE);
                    __try
                    {
                        m_csNumDownloadThreads.Lock();
                        // both download and unpacking is done, start
                        // timer to destroy the progress window in 500ms
                        if (!m_destroyWindowTimerStarted &&
                               m_numDownloadThreadsRunning == 0) {
                            SetTimer(destroyWindowTimerID, POST_DELAY);
                            m_destroyWindowTimerStarted = TRUE;
                        }
                    }
                    __finally
                    {
                        m_csNumDownloadThreads.Unlock();
                    }
                }

                // Update status message
                ::SetWindowText(hStatusWnd, szBuffer);
            }
        }
        __finally
        {
           m_csDownload.Unlock();
        }
    }

    return 0;
}
